2018-02-28net-snmp: PR kern/52945: snmpd does not work under current 8.0_BETAmaya3-3/+32
it seems that configure cannot detect IP_PKTINFO correctly because of using SOL_IP. SOL_IP is not defined on *BSD. And on netbsd, struct ip_pktinfo has no ipi_spec_dst. From Ryo Shimizu. PKGREVISION++

2017-10-06net-snmp: Prevent crash on NetBSD/i386gavan3-5/+14
A compiler bug causes incorrect compilation of the NetBSD-specific code in cpu_sysctl.c. This results in a crash shortly after startup if the machine has 2 or more CPUs. Disable optimisation in netsnmp_cpu_arch_load() only. This works around the problem reported in PR pkg/50939.

2013-03-17Update to 5.7.2.gdt53-2599/+134
This is a major update in terms of pkgsrc patches, of which there are far far too many. Analysis of patches was done by Karen Sirois of BBN, and I have remvoed patches that have been applied upstream. This builds fine and passes tests on NetBSD 6 i386. If you look after some other platform (Dragonfly, Darwin, FreeBSD, etc.), please make sure any problems are filed as upstream tickets; pkgsrc is not appropriate to carry patches long-term that should be fixed upstream, and this package has gotten out of hand. (OK by adam@ to do the update, but he has not reviewed the changes, so errors are my fault. It's quite likely there are issues on other platforms.)
